What Makes a Vodka Smooth?
Before we dive into specific vodkas, it’s important to understand what makes a vodka smooth in the first place. There are several factors that can contribute to a vodka’s smoothness, including the quality of the ingredients used, the distillation process, and the filtration methods employed.
High-quality ingredients are essential for creating a smooth vodka. Vodkas made from top-notch grains or potatoes tend to have a smoother finish than those made from inferior ingredients. Additionally, the distillation process plays a crucial role in the final product. Vodkas that are distilled multiple times are often smoother and more refined than those that undergo fewer distillations.
Filtration is another key factor that can impact a vodka’s smoothness. Many vodka producers filter their spirits through charcoal or other materials to remove impurities and enhance the overall taste. The more times a vodka is filtered, the smoother it is likely to be.

1. Belvedere Vodka
Belvedere is a premium Polish vodka known for its smooth, clean taste. Made from 100% Polska rye and distilled four times, Belvedere is renowned for its exceptional quality and smooth finish. This vodka is perfect for sipping neat or mixing into your favorite cocktails.
2. Grey Goose Vodka
Grey Goose is a French vodka made from high-quality wheat and distilled five times for maximum smoothness. This award-winning vodka is beloved for its crisp, clean taste and velvety texture. Whether enjoyed on the rocks or in a martini, Grey Goose is sure to impress even the most discerning vodka connoisseur.
3. Tito’s Handmade Vodka
Tito’s Handmade Vodka is an American favorite known for its smooth, slightly sweet flavor profile. Made from corn and distilled six times, Tito’s is gluten-free and perfect for those with dietary restrictions. This versatile vodka is great for mixing into cocktails or enjoying on its own.
4. Chopin Potato Vodka
Chopin Potato Vodka is a Polish vodka made from locally sourced potatoes, resulting in a creamy, smooth texture. Distilled four times and filtered through charcoal, Chopin is free from additives and artificial flavors. This vodka is a great choice for those looking for a rich, full-bodied spirit with a smooth finish.
5. Ketel One Vodka
Ketel One is a Dutch vodka crafted from 100% wheat and distilled in copper pot stills for a smooth, velvety taste. Known for its signature crispness and citrus notes, Ketel One is a versatile vodka that can be enjoyed on its own or mixed into a variety of cocktails.
